AR and VR in Market Overview

The technology behind augmented reality (AR) enables a smart device to overlay information, films, and visuals on top of the real world. By viewing new data that has been blended into the real environment, this technology enables users to enhance the real world. The L'Oréal Makeup app, Pokémon Go, and the IKEA Place app are a few well-known instances of AR. Virtual reality (VR) is a type of computer-generated virtual reality in which a person is submerged in a digital setting. The most popular VR applications include VR chats, Volvo test drives, The North Face's Yosemite National Park hiking experience, and a huge selection of VR games.

Augmented reality redefined the healthcare industry with its expanding use of connected devices coupled with artificial intelligence. Augmented reality is a technology that incorporates digital information into a real-world environment. It provides a new approach to treatments and education in medicine. AR helps in patient treatment and surgery planning. Also, it helps to enlighten complex medical situations to the patients and their relatives.

What is the Role of AI in the Market?

Integrating artificial intelligence (AI) in AR and VR technologies transforms the healthcare sector, enhancing patient outcomes and providing advanced care. AI can achieve continuous and more complete real-time patient monitoring. AI and machine learning (ML) algorithms can aid in the early diagnosis and detection of chronic disorders, increasing precision and accuracy in diagnostics. They can also suggest better-personalized care solutions to patients. AI in holographic telemedicine leads to remote consultations with 3D holographic representations of doctors and patients. Several companies use AI to develop immersive VR technologies, enhancing interactivity. Moreover, AI can provide advanced healthcare solutions with the advent of voice commands in AR and VR through speech recognition. Thus, AI in AR and VR act as personal assistants to patients, reducing the workload on healthcare professionals.
